(i am repostingthe question plsansurgent):a metal cube of side 11 cm is completely submerged in a water contained in a cylindrical vessel with diameter 28 cm, find the rise in level of water ?

Given : Diameter of cylindrical vessel  =  28 cm , So radius  = 14 cm 

And when cube submerged rise in water level  = h

Edge of cube  = 11  and we know volume of cube  = ( Edge )3 , So

Volume of given cube  = 113 = 1331


We know volume of cylinder  = π r2 h , So

Volume of water  = 227 × 142 × h =227 × 14× 14× h =  22 × 2 × 14×h =  616 h cm3
Here , when a cube is submerged into a cylindrical vessel, the volume of water displaced is equal to the volume of cube .

Therefore,

616 h =  1331

h 1331616

h 12156 = 2956

So,

Rise in water level  =   2956 cm                                                        (  Ans )
